RELEVANT EXPERIENCE:

Rob is currently CEO of the L’Estrange Group, providing high-end corporate governance advisory services to corporate Australia and major inbound investors.

Rob had a distinguished 30 year plus career with PricewaterhouseCoopers (PwC), including serving as Global Managing Partner of PwC’s worldwide audit practice comprising 78,000 people across 148 countries. This was during the period after the collapse of Arthur Andersen when trust needed to be restored in the profession globally.

As global audit leader, Rob lead the design, build and rollout of PwC’s system for the delivery of the audit.

Other roles with PwC included National Managing Partner of the Australian firm, Australia’s largest professional services organisation. During his tenure, Rob doubled profitability per partner while leading a major program to create a distinctive PwC culture.

On his return to Australia, Rob created and lead PwC Australia’s Public Policy formulation group and served as the inaugural Chair of the Australian Public Policy Committee.
